1. Construction and Infrastructure
Infrastructure Growth: The construction and infrastructure sector is the largest consumer of steel, driven by urbanization, population growth, and infrastructure development.
Urbanization: Rapid urbanization and the expansion of cities increase the demand for steel in building structures, including residential, commercial, and industrial buildings.
Infrastructure Projects: Largescale infrastructure projects such as bridges, highways, and railways require substantial amounts of steel for durability and strength. Government investments in infrastructure further boost steel demand.
Example: The construction of highrise buildings and extensive transportation networks in developing countries drives significant steel consumption, as steel is essential for structural frameworks and reinforcement.
2. Automotive Industry
Vehicle Production: The automotive industry is a major driver of steel demand due to its need for various steel products in vehicle manufacturing.
Lightweight Materials: The shift towards lighter, more fuelefficient vehicles has led to increased use of advanced highstrength steel (AHSS) and other steel alloys. Automakers seek materials that provide strength while reducing vehicle weight.
Production Volumes: High production volumes of cars, trucks, and other vehicles contribute to steady steel demand. Steel is used in body panels, frames, engines, and exhaust systems.
Example: The trend towards electric vehicles (EVs) and the adoption of new steel technologies to improve vehicle safety and performance influence the types and quantities of steel required in automotive manufacturing.
3. Energy Sector
Energy Infrastructure: The energy sector drives steel demand through the construction and maintenance of energy infrastructure, including oil and gas pipelines, power plants, and renewable energy facilities.
Oil and Gas: Steel is used in the construction of pipelines, storage tanks, and drilling rigs, with demand fluctuating based on oil and gas exploration and production activities.
Renewable Energy: The rise of renewable energy sources, such as wind and solar power, requires specialized steel products for wind turbines, solar panel frames, and related infrastructure.
Example: The expansion of renewable energy projects and upgrades to existing energy infrastructure contribute to increased steel demand, driven by the need for durable and reliable materials.
4. Manufacturing and Machinery
Industrial Equipment: The manufacturing and machinery sector relies on steel for producing industrial equipment, machinery, and tools.
Machine Components: Steel’s strength and durability make it a preferred material for manufacturing machine components, including gears, bearings, and shafts.
Production Equipment: Steel is also used in the production of equipment such as conveyors, presses, and fabrication tools, which are essential for various manufacturing processes.
Example: The demand for steel in the machinery sector can be influenced by industrial automation trends, technological advancements, and changes in manufacturing processes.
5. Packaging Industry
Packaging Materials: The packaging industry uses steel primarily in the production of cans, containers, and other packaging materials.
Food and Beverage Packaging: Steel is widely used for packaging food and beverages due to its strength, safety, and recyclability. The demand for packaged goods and changes in consumer preferences impact steel usage in this sector.
Sustainability: Increasing emphasis on recycling and sustainable packaging solutions drives demand for steel as it is highly recyclable and can be repurposed for new products.
Example: The rise in global consumer goods and the focus on sustainable packaging drive steel demand in the packaging industry, as manufacturers seek materials that are both functional and environmentally friendly.
